Leadership Review Briefing — Project Lanternfish

Quick heads-up for branch managers ahead of Thursday's review: Lanternfish, our internal scheduling overhaul, is now running eight weeks behind. The slip traces back to the data migration from the old Corvid system, which turned out messier than anyone at Halwick Group expected. Priya's team has a recovery plan and the revised go-live is early spring. Costs are holding, morale is fine. Before the session, please read the confidential note below.

management briefing: Project Ulavan slips by two quarters because of the staffing delay.

Subject: Partner SFTP drop — new owner

Hi,

As you review the pending changes to the Harborline ingest scripts, note that ownership of the partner SFTP drop is changing at the end of the month. This includes key rotation, the nightly pull job, and the quarantine folder for malformed files. Review comments on the retry logic should still go through the normal PR flow, but questions about drop-folder conventions or partner onboarding now go to the new owner. The incoming owner is listed below.

signatory, tagaf-bahaf: Praael Fenmir Rusok

Handover note — Crumbwheel order cutoffs.

Welcome aboard. The bakery cutoff rule in Crumbwheel closes same-day orders at 14:00 local to each storefront, not UTC — this has bitten us twice. Holiday overrides live in the calendar service and take precedence silently, so always check there first when a cutoff looks wrong. To unlock the calendar service's admin console after a restart, enter the recovery passphrase below.

vault phrase of bagap-bahaf = silion-pelox-sorox-casdor-quenwyn-fraax-eliox-praael-kelion-quenvan-kasox-rusael-norius-belvan